A undeniable fact there’s no better feeling than when you’re wearing a cosy shoe. Comfortable  shoes let us enjoy the day’s activities pain free. Wearing shoes that fit correctly can also forestall potential health problems from going down.

Shoes  can last a mean of three to twelve months. As you begin to wear out a shoe, you begin to note a difference nicely. Worn out shoes may lead to back rigidity, sore knee joints, or distressing feet. The time to replace your shoes is when the cushion has broken down or the motion control has been lost. Which Shoes To Buy?  Everyone’s foot is dissimilar.

A high arched foot does not roll inward unusual much at all. There is a highly curved arch along the inside of the foot. Also, the toes appear to be in a clawed position.

Highly arched feet are truly stiff and are unable to take in shock when making contact with the ground. The reason behind this is the foot is not ready to roll inward when the foot makes contact with the ground. Inserting special pads in the shoes, which compensate for this condition, treats highly arched feet. The pads allow the feet to take in shock faster. Folk with high arched feet, should attempt to keep away from stability or motion control shoes, which reduce foot mobility.

The term Flat Feet makes reference to folk who have got a low arch, or no arch at all. Occasionally they are claimed to have’fallen arches’. Over pronation is the overboard inward rolling motion of the foot. This inward motion is regarded unhealthy as it could cause a large amount of load on the back, ankles, knees, and lower legs. Under pronation takes place when the outside of the foot takes the brunt of the shock when coming in contact with the ground. This condition could cause issues with the ligaments in your feet and ankles.

Stability shoes feature either a twin density midsole or a roll bar to help combat pronation issues.

Your foot size changes yearly. Always measure your foot first. This should give you a general range when thinking about different styles of shoes.

It should have a soft and supportive cushion. People  with high arches often need more support. Stand up and take a fast walk to get an understanding of the shoe. Your feet should not slide around within and there should be small bit of room beyond the biggest toe. But less than 0.5 in… Remember : you shouldn’t have to’break in’ a tight shoe.
